Title
A fully integratable, 1.55 /spl mu/m wavelength, continuously tunable asymmetric twin-waveguide distributed Bragg reflector laser

Abstract
We demonstrate a fully integratable distributed Bragg reflector laser at 1.548 /spl mu/m. The device has a threshold of 50 mA and output power of 13 mW, with a tuning range of 4.8 nm and a linewidth of 146 kHz.
